AI-generatedRising jet fuel costs due to Iran war push airfares up 21%, reducing the value of airline miles for consumers. Airlines pass costs via higher fares and baggage fees. Credit card issuers offer large bonuses to attract customers, but rewards lose purchasing power. Sector impact: airlines face margin pressure from fuel costs but can pass through via pricing; consumer discretionary spending on travel may soften; oil prices directly affect jet fuel input costs.
